Vandalism Alert

Almond and other schools in the Los Altos School District have recently experienced several incidents of vandalism. Similar vandalism and destruction of property has also been experienced in the neighborhoods surrounding our schools.  Recent incidents on school campuses have included fires being set, school gardens being damaged, alcoholic beverage bottles being broken, and graffiti being sprayed on buildings. Neighborhoods have experienced similar destruction of property, along with car break-ins and minor property thefts.   In an effort to protect our schools and neighborhoods, we ask that any suspicious activity on any campus be reported immediately to the Los Altos Police at 947-2770. Please talk to your neighbors about any suspicious behavior in your neighborhood. By working together as a community, we can minimize these incidents – thereby protecting our neighborhoods and providing a safe environment for our children.

Intra-district (Open Enrollment) Transfers

The Los Altos School District has a policy of Open Enrollment that permits students living within district boundaries to attend a school other than their neighborhood school, subject to space availability. Requests for an intra-district transfer must be submitted to the District Office by February 15. An intra-district transfer approval in grades K-6 is in effect for one school year.  Intra-district requests must be submitted annually and approval will be based on space available at the requested school. To access the complete policy #5116.1, go to “Board Policies and Administrative Regulations” at the bottom of the LASD site.  Transfer request forms are available at the District Office.
